+/// The check that looks for long integral constants and inserts the digits
+/// separator (') appropriately. Groupings:
+///     - decimal integral constants, groups of 3 digits, e.g. int x = 1'000;
+///     - binary integral constants, groups of 4 digits, e.g. int x =
+///     0b0010'0011;
+///     - octal integral constants, groups of 3 digits, e.g. int x = 0377'777;
+///     - hexadecimal integral constants, groups of 4 digits, e.g. unsigned long
+///     x = 0xffff'0000;
+///     - floating-point constants, group into 3 digits on either side of the
+///     decimal point, e.g. float x = 3'456.001'25f;
